网页链接提取技巧大全:快速高效获取目标链接208


在互联网时代,信息的获取和利用至关重要。而网页链接作为连接信息的重要桥梁,其提取和使用技巧也成为许多人关注的焦点。本文将详细介绍各种网页链接提取方法,涵盖手动提取、使用浏览器插件、利用编程技术等多个方面,帮助您快速高效地获取目标链接。

一、手动提取网页链接:最基础的方法

对于简单的网页,手动复制粘贴链接是最直接、最基础的方法。这种方法适用于链接数量较少,且页面结构清晰的情况。具体步骤如下:
打开目标网页:使用浏览器打开需要提取链接的网页。
找到目标链接:仔细浏览网页内容,找到需要提取的链接,通常以蓝色下划线文本的形式呈现。
右键点击链接:鼠标右键点击目标链接。
复制链接地址:在弹出的菜单中选择“复制链接地址”或类似选项,将链接复制到剪贴板。
粘贴链接:将复制的链接粘贴到您需要的文档或程序中。

手动提取链接虽然简单,但效率低下,尤其在需要提取大量链接的情况下,这种方法非常耗时。因此,它更适合处理少量链接的情况。

二、使用浏览器插件:提升效率的利器

为了提高效率,许多浏览器插件可以帮助用户快速提取网页链接。这些插件通常具有批量提取、过滤链接类型等功能,大大简化了操作流程。一些常用的插件包括:
LinkClump (Chrome): 支持鼠标拖拽选择多个链接,并将其复制到剪贴板。
Copy All Links (Chrome, Firefox): 一键复制页面所有链接。
Data Miner (Chrome): 功能强大的数据提取工具,可以自定义提取规则,选择特定类型的链接。

这些插件的使用方法通常都很简单,安装后即可直接在浏览器中使用。用户只需打开目标网页,然后使用插件提供的功能即可快速提取所需的链接。需要注意的是,不同插件的功能和使用方法略有差异,用户需要根据实际需求选择合适的插件。

三、利用编程技术:自动化提取的终极方案

对于需要处理大量网页链接的情况,使用编程技术进行自动化提取是最高效的方法。常用的编程语言包括Python、JavaScript等。通过编写程序,可以实现批量下载、过滤和处理链接等功能。

Python示例: 使用Python的`requests`和`Beautiful Soup`库可以轻松提取网页链接:
import requests
from bs4 import BeautifulSoup
url = "目标网页URL"
response = (url)
soup = BeautifulSoup(, "")
for link in soup.find_all("a", href=True):
print(link["href"])

这段代码首先使用`requests`库获取网页内容,然后使用`Beautiful Soup`库解析HTML,最后提取所有``标签中的`href`属性值,即网页链接。 这只是一个简单的例子,实际应用中可能需要根据网页结构进行调整。

JavaScript示例 (浏览器控制台): 可以直接在浏览器控制台中运行JavaScript代码提取链接:
let links = (('a')).map(a => );
(links);

这段代码会选取页面所有``标签,并将其`href`属性值存储在一个数组中,然后打印到控制台。 您可以复制打印出的数组内容。

四、注意事项:
尊重网站: 在使用任何自动化工具提取链接之前,请务必检查网站的文件,以确保您不会违反网站的规定。
避免过度抓取: 过度抓取会给网站服务器带来压力,甚至可能导致您的IP被封禁。请控制抓取频率,并添加合适的延时。
处理链接的相对路径: 有些链接是相对路径,需要根据当前网页URL进行拼接才能得到完整的链接。
数据清洗: 提取到的链接可能包含一些无效链接或重复链接,需要进行数据清洗处理。
遵守网站的使用条款: 在使用任何方法提取链接时,请务必遵守网站的使用条款和版权规定。

总之,提取网页链接的方法有很多种,选择哪种方法取决于您需要处理的链接数量、网页结构以及您的技术水平。 希望本文能够帮助您更好地掌握网页链接提取技巧,提高工作效率。

2025-03-17


上一篇:网站如何添加百度超链接:提升SEO和用户体验的完整指南

下一篇:HTML超链接颜色:深入指南及最佳实践